- W2126162317 abstract "Underwater explosions in the Kirkcaldy Bay region of the Firth of Forth, Scotland, recorded by the British Geological Survey's LOWNET array (Crampin et al.) generate seismograms which are characterized by a long dispersed wavetrain. On the assumption that these waves are caused by the shape of the dispersion curves, phase and group velocities are analysed to determine the structural parameters of a model of the Kirkcaldy Bay region to which they are most sensitive. The shear-wave velocity and thickness of the sea-bottom sediments are found to be most influential in determining the shape of these dispersion curves. Simple synthetic seismograms constructed for a solid model of the Kirkcaldy Bay region (formed by excluding the water and sediment layers) confirm that the extended wavetrain cannot be caused by the source. The source effects increase the duration of the seismogram by only a few seconds, compared to over 30 s for the effects of dispersion, and are thus not significant. It is demonstrated that, for surface wave studies intended to probe the deeper solid basement using underwater explosions, care must be exercised in selecting a shot location free from significant sediment thickness because these sediments effectively screen structure to between 10 and 100 times their own depth. On the other hand the Kirkcaldy Bay surface wave seismograms also illustrate the detail with which sediment structure may be determined for acoustic and geological studies; for example a 40-m thick sea-bed sedimentary layer with shear-wave velocity of about 0.2 km s−1 is resolved overlying a 1.4 km s−1 solid layer of 260 m thickness." @default.
